All alumnae/i of The College of New Rochelle are automatically members of the Alumnae/i Association which supports the mission of CNR through its goals and programs.

Alumnae/i who hold elected positions have a term that begins July 1 and hold staggering positions for two or three years.  If you would like more information on the Alumnae/i Association or to view the job description please see below.

Five Essential Elements of CNR
Liberal Arts Tradition
Career Preparation
Catholic Heritage
Commitment to Diversity
Commitment to Women

A. Committees will look for natural connections to the five essential elements of the College and emphasize those affinities when setting goals for the year.

B. Committees will set goals that assist in making connections between alumnae/i and current students in the four schools.

C. Committees will stay mindful of reaching out to graduates of the four schools from 1970 to the present, while setting goals that may target selected constituencies for effectiveness.

D. Committees will look for ways to incorporate the College’s fifth Institutional Priority Students and alumnae/i of all Schools assume responsibility for the future financial health of the College, into all activities and programming.
